Size

Wine refrigerators are available in different sizes. The size of the wine cooler you need will depend on how many bottles you intend to store and your drinking habits. Small wine coolers can store anything from 12 to 36 bottles of your favourite wines. Medium wine coolers can store up to 100 bottles and are usually 24 inches in width. Larger wine refrigerators can accommodate up 200 bottles and are designed for serious wine enthusiasts.

freestanding wine chiller wine fridges need a ventilation gap of 30cm above and 5-10cm beneath. Fully integrated or built-in wine fridges are recessed into cabinets for an elegant and refined appearance. Built-in wine fridges are designed with front venting to allow them to fit into cabinets with minimal clearance.

Single-zone wine refrigerators keep all of your wines at the same temperature, which may be ok if you drink your wine quickly. However, if you are planning to age your wines for years, it is crucial to select the right storage solution that can preserve the integrity of your wine, and allow it to develop full flavors over time.

Capacity of Bottles

The capacity of a bottle on an under counter wine cooler is the number of bottles it can hold. Usually, the wine rack is designed to accommodate Bordeaux-sized bottles of standard size, however some models can be adjusted to accommodate different sizes of bottles. If you're unsure of the size bottles will fit into your under counter wine fridge, visit the website of the manufacturer to download their mini wine refrigerator capacity chart for bottles.

The energy efficiency of an under-counter wine refrigerator is a further factor to take into consideration. Select a model with an auto-defrost feature, double-paned glass and eco-friendly refrigerant. These features will save you money and prolong the life of the compressor.

Energy-efficient wine coolers are not just a guarantee that your wines are stored at a suitable temperature however, they also consume less energy and have a smaller environmental impact than standard models. You can save energy costs by choosing a model that comes with an Energy Star rating.

The type of cooling technology is another factor in determining the energy efficiency of the refrigerator. The coolers available cool the bottles using compression or thermoelectric technology. Thermoelectric units utilize a small amount of energy to draw warm air into the room, while compressors function like standard household refrigerators by using an internal thermostat.

Maintaining your wine cooler will also reduce its energy consumption. Avoid placing it in direct sunlight or near other sources of heat and make sure you examine the coils on a regular basis to ensure that they are not hindered by dirt or other debris. Keep the door as closed as you can and don't open it more than is necessary for retrieving or storing wine.

Noise Level

Wine coolers keep your wine at a constant temperature. The cooling units are always working to maintain the temperature, which is why they tend to produce some noise. The noise can range from barely noticeable to annoyingly intrusive. The best home wine fridge way to prevent this is by choosing a quieter wine cooler. But, this isn't always feasible.

The most common type of wine fridges rely on compressors to operate. They are more energy-efficient however they generate more noise. This is because the refrigeration system needs to be larger. This can lead to an increase in vibrations. This can lead to unpleasant humming sounds or even a clicking sound.

These vibrations may cause your wine to lose its natural flavor and aroma. If you're thinking of buying a wine fridge, make sure you check the noise level before making your purchase. Some manufacturers claim that their wine refrigerators are quiet however this is often false. To be sure to be sure, read reviews and specifications for objective information about the wine cooler's decibel level.
